    ZF is a global leader in active and passive safety technology and in how those technologies can work together. The future of mobilitypresents new challenges for safety concepts. Intelligent driver assist systems proactively help to prevent accidents between roadusers. To help enable and support this, ZF develops and produces a wide range of electronic and computer-controlled systems aswell as sensor technologies. When an accident is unavoidable, sophisticated airbags and seat belt systems are designed to improveoccupant protection. ZF innovations help to enhance road safety for vehicle occupants and additionally for other road users byconnecting its active, passive and driver assistance safety technologies.

    General Summary:

    Updates current and develops new software and Artificial Intelligence (AI) solutions to improve efficiencies in manufacturing and support group processes. Uses data analytics to determine feasibility of AI solutions to further enhance efficiency and cost savings in the business.

     

    Essential Duties & Responsibilities:

    + Provides application development using C# and Visual Studio.

    + Designs and maintains databases using Oracle, SQL Server and MySQL.

    + Analyses processes and systems for data analytics and AI integration.

    + Makes decisions regarding system, network, application code changes and system reconfigurations.

    + Plans strategies to improve equipment efficiency and availability based on automation and digitalization.

    + Defines project phases, estimates the phases and establishes schedules.

    + Plans work for self and establishes priorities where appropriate.

    + Communicates frequently with internal customers and suppliers.

    + Expected to do analysis work defining the problem and preparing solutions.

    + Seeks outside knowledge to stay current on industry advances.

    + Provides support in manufacturing applications in the areas of production support, traceability, cell control, line datacollection, packaging, labeling, dock management, production reports, web development, customer returns, databaseadministration, auto backflushing, technical training, downtime analysis, and system definition.

    + Ensures smooth operation of systems affecting the production equipment.

    + Creates custom reports from manufacturing data.

    + Ensures timely response to disturbances in the managed systems.

    + Creates and programs software for analysis and statistics.

    + Coordinates tasks with production areas.

    + Participates in Production IT Security related activities.

    + Participates in on-call schedule of the group to support operations outside of normal office working hours.

    Ability:

    + In-depth understanding of software systems.

    + Proficient use of PC, M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int).

    + Self-directed, self-motivated, strong accountability, enthusiastic learner with attention to details.

    + Strong communication skills with internal and external project stakeholders.

    + Ability to communicate technical details both verbally and in writing.

    + Ability to work across a multi-cultural environment andglobal distributed projects.

    + Strong analytical skills for root cause analysis.

    + Willingness and ability to work flexible hours occasionally for collaboration with colleagues in different time zones and tosupport local manufacturing.

    + Commitment and desire to learn manufacturing processes with the goal of becoming a go-toresource for technical solutions.

    Education:

    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or related technical discipline required.

    Experience:

    + 0 to 8+ yrs of professional experience.

    + Strongly Preferred:

    + C#, Entity Framework, WinForms, ASP.Net webforms and MVC, SQL, experience with SQL Server.

    + A plus:

    + Knowledge and experience in factory automation, knowledge of Programmable Logic Controllers, Python, German language skills, Oracle, MySQL
